Output 20d57294c85879fa7d203ee38fa1b41ff97d6ce00c35bd41818cf57dca2f695a:2

value
11203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30666ffdcbceba4d1fd89daca124eb9c8af33539 OP_EQUAL
address
366w5EPCs9ZGAXzgv5SjWyFGt6yZT2gUDr
transaction
20d57294c85879fa7d203ee38fa1b41ff97d6ce00c35bd41818cf57dca2f695a
confirmations
48520
spent
true